Miss Cora Bruner and Mr. Fred Rhoades Maried Saturday
A telegram received here Saturday by the Republican from the Chicago Tribune stated that Miss Cora Bruner of Morocco and Mr. Fred Rhoades, of 5522 South Park Ave., were married in that city Saturday afternoon, the marriage following closely that of Mr. and Mrs. Jay Newels. Miss Bruner is the daughter of Mr. and Mrs. J. F. Bruner, of Morocco, who prior to their removal to that ?>lace made this city their residence or a great many years. Miss Bruner has a great many friends in this city where the most of her life- has been spent and was one of our most attractive young ladies. Mr. Rhoades is the son of Mr, and Mrs. €. W. Rhoades of this city. The groom has been in Chicago for the past year or so where he has studied architectural work and is now engaged in that line. The marriage followed a courtship which has extended oyer the past severalyears, the romance starting during their school days in this city. The many friends of Mr. and Mrs. Rhoades will extend to them their wish for a life of happiness.
